Coral

After being considered for a bit too classic for summer, almost trivial, the coral color is back to being cool thanks to the revival of Tumblr vibes, bright colors and that slightly nostalgic Instagram filter aesthetic. Halfway between red and orange, coral is the perfect shade for those who want a lively and bright manicure without going to the most extreme fluo. Needless to say, it looks great with tanning and works both on short, simple nails and longer shapes.

Seaglass Nails

Seaglass nails are inspired by those fragments of stained glass polished by the sea that are found on the beach confused between stones and shells. The shades range from water green to light blue, with finishes that can be opaque or glossy, with a wet glass effect.

Sugar Nails

Sugar nails are the perfect manicure for those who want to add a bit of panache in August. The effect is precisely that of crystallized sugar: a fine glitter powder covers the surface creating a slightly three-dimensional texture, just as if the nails had just been passed in a dusting of sugar. Funfetti nails

To stay on the subject of pastry, apparently this summer we decided to look sweeter than usual, let's move on to funfetti nails, which are inspired by the small colorful sugar candies that decorate cupcakes and American birthday cakes. The base usually remains bare or transparent, while the multicolored details are added on top and can be made by hand, or with the help of sequins and small rhinestones.
